So I have never liked a Les Paul before. Either the pups didn't move me or too heavy or the neck was too odd. Well making my weekly check of pawn shops and guitar stores turned up a LP that was cheap. So I grab it, frets ends are sharp. Back of headstock says 2009, dang, these pickups sound great! WWhat the hell am I playing here? Truss cover says "Studio" but I've never seen one like this. The neck is different, its slim, and comfy.

 

What gives?

 

Well a bit a research turns up an Ebony Studio line was built for GC/MF, Burstbucker pros w/o covers and a " slim 60's neck". Well, well, well. I must play it again just to make sure I wasn't drunk or something.

 

Yep, its real. yep its cool. yep I bought it.
